Montelocco Bianco

Venturini Baldini

A classic sparkling white of Emilia-Romagna, this brut expression of the region’s chief white variety pours bright yellow with green highlights and a gently frizzante bead and a heady bouquet. Like opening a dole’s fruit cup—the one’s with the preserved peaches and that one red cherry somewhere in there—in the middle of a flower shop, the wine has a juicy, fun-loving flare and an easy acidity. Quite simply, this is a happy wine. At the risk of casting the shadow of kitsch over a seriously well made wine, there is something about this drop that reminds me of my brief but happy addiction to Mountain Dew in the eighth grade. It’s intoxicating. An ideal aperitif with the always difficult to pair egg dishes of Sunday brunch and a fast friend to shellfish and mildly matured cheeses as well.

Country:  Italy

Region:  Emilia-Romagna

Appellation:  Malvasia Emilia IGP

Climate:  Moderate Mediterranean

Altitude:  240m

Soils:  Clay & Sand

Varietal/Blend:  Malvasia di Candia Aromatica

Fermentation:  Charmat Method.

Ageing:  6 months. 8g/l RS.

Vineyard & Vine Age:  Estate Vineyards, Organic

ABV:  11%
